The video discusses various aspects of inflation, focusing on the Fed's preferred measures and targets. It highlights the impact of the coronavirus on inflation trends and economic outlook, noting that inflation may be lower than expected. The discussion also covers corporate earnings, wage growth, and their effects on inflation. Additionally, the video examines the debt market, interest rates, and how they are influenced by the current economic conditions.
